Depth-resolved soil data from DOE-LM Riverton Wyoming site, April-September 2017

Averaged (from 3 to 5 replicates) and QA/QC:d data for soil cores taken roughly every month in the period April 5 to September 13 in 2017 at a location close to DOE Legacy Management well 855 at the Riverton, Wyoming floodplain site. The groundwater at this site exhibits persistent U, Mo, and sulfate plumes and is one of the field sites in focus for the SLAC Groundwater Quality SFA program. Cores were separated into 5-20 cm segments based on soil horizonation and each segment was subsampled for microbial analyses (data available at the NCBI Single Read Archive (SRA) Database, https://www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/sra/, BioProject ID# PRJNA626616) in addition to the soil analyses included in this dataset. The soil analyses dataset includes aerobic and anaerobic respiration rate estimates (MicroResp method), water content estimates (on collected samples, not in situ), total C, N, S, Ca, K, Mg, Na, Fe, As, Mo, U, and organic-C concentrations, water extractable concentrations of the same elements, and HCl-extractable Fe(II) concentrations.There are four files included in this data package: metadataFile.csv, avgDataFile.csv, methodFile.csv, and RVT2017soilData.xlsx. The excel file contains the same information as the individual csv-files (in separate tabs).
